What you will do

This position is designed to strengthen UPM Plywood’s organization and enable future opportunities for the business. We are looking for an Enterprise Architect to define, develop, and maintain our enterprise IT architecture vision, including roadmap and governance, ensuring alignment between business strategy and IT capabilities.

In addition, your responsibilities include:

  • Develop and maintain the enterprise architecture framework and documentation

  • Align IT architecture with business strategy, portfolios, and project objectives

  • Lead cross-team architecture initiatives and governance boards

  • Define and oversee architecture standards, principles, and compliance

  • Guide technology decisions and evaluate emerging technologies and solutions

  • Ensure integration and consistency across IT domains

  • Advise on major transformation and digitalization initiatives

Who you are

  • You are an experienced IT professional with a strong background in enterprise-level design and governance.

  • You have experience in IT architecture roles, with expertise in enterprise-level design and governance

  • You have strong knowledge across business, processes, applications, data, and technology architecture domains

  • You are familiar with known architecture frameworks and modeling tools

  • You have the ability to influence across teams and guide architectural decisions

  • You have excellent communication skills and strategic thinking

UPM Plywood offers high quality WISA® plywood and veneer products for construction, vehicle flooring, LNG shipbuilding, parquet manufacturing and other industrial applications. In 2024, UPM Plywood sales was EUR 430 million and it employs about 1600 people. UPM has four plywood mills and one veneer mill in Finland as well as a plywood mill in Estonia. www.wisaplywood.com

UPM’s Board of Directors has approved a demerger plan concerning the separation of the UPM Plywood business into a new independent listed company, subject to approval by UPM’s shareholders and other customary conditions, as announced in the company’s stock exchange release on April 29, 2026.
